Ecwid’s ease-of-use
Ecwid’s intuitive control panel makes it easy to set up a shop. Anyone with WordPress experience should be able to pick up the system quickly and easily. After signing up for the free plan, you’ll be taken to your admin area where you can create your store. You can then add products to your store by clicking on the tabs. Clicking on tabs across the top of the page will give you access to list attributes, add additional images, and adjust tax and shipping information. You can add meta descriptions to your products by clicking on the tabs.

The free plan will let you set up a basic store with just ten products. Once your shop grows, you can upgrade to a more advanced plan for a low fee. Once you reach a paid plan, you’ll have access to more features and a personal account manager. The downside to the free plan is that it only has a few basic features. You will also be limited in the number of products you can purchase and the inventory that you have.

Ecwid allows you to customize the layout of your store, but it has some limitations. Although Ecwid doesn’t have drag-and-drop editors available, you can modify fonts, colors and styles in a variety of ways. Even then, you may be frustrated with the process if you aren’t an expert in web design. Then again, you could always hire a professional designer to do the work for you.

Another major feature of Ecwid is its multi-lingual capabilities. With more than 50 languages available, Ecwid allows you to sell to customers who don’t speak English. This is great news especially for international businesses. If you plan to sell to international buyers, the free plan will allow you to open a store in multiple countries. Although you may need to pay for multi-language capabilities, the free plan offers a lot of great benefits at a low price.

Zapier allows you to automate your business processes, connecting your Ecwid store with popular apps and services. Zapier allows you create custom integrations that allow you to connect Ecwid to popular services such as Twitter, Google Sheets, etc. You can also create Zaps to automate certain tasks, such as email marketing or Twitter, without needing to know how to code. You can easily set up an integration with a few clicks.
